Man Up Uk Fox - Man Up Uk Tv

1man up uk fox
2man up uk tv show
3man up uk tv seriesThis latter additionhas been proven to be most successful with late stage cancers, which until nowhave had dismal outcomes, often with less than 10% 5-year survival rates.
4man up uk tv
5man up